Tenniel's distinctive style caught the attention of Charles Dodgson, a writer with the pen name Lewis Carroll. Tenniel and Carroll met in 1864 and Tenniel agreed to illustrate Alice's Adventures in Wonderland.

Happy 200th Birthday to Sir John Tenniel, most famous for his illustrations of Alice in Wonderland. He was the first illustrator or cartoonist to be knighted, in 1893

Arthur Rackham's Gothic Alice in Wonderland illustrations. At the time, in 1907, many felt that Sir John Tenniel’s original illustrations for Alice (1865) had become so iconic that any other interpretation was blasphemy. However, Rackham made Alice both more sweet & more scary.
